Contains opinion papers on important issues in database. Even though Relational Systems dominate the database landscape, the Relational Model is under attack from within. The Relational Model suffers from poor implementations. The products from major Relational DBMS vendors are proprietary, contain wellknown bugs and are weak in Relational Functionality. Standards, including ODBC, are held hostage by large vendors with their own predatory agenda. The Relational Model and Open Standards are pawns in the competitive battles between the giants.The users of database systems are the ones shortchanged by the inadequacies of these systems. The computer press is concerned with bells & whistles and with topselling products, ignoring the real issues of usability, compatibility and functionality. This forum will try to shed some light on these areas.
